Birkirkara
·
Hybrid Remote
Integrations Tech Lead
Role Overview:
We are seeking an experienced and driven Integrations Tech Lead to take ownership of our direct and reverse integration processes. This role involves becoming a subject matter expert in our integration APIs, identifying and implementing improvements, and driving the onboarding of new developers in this domain. The ideal candidate will have a deep understanding of Java backend development, system integrations, and API design.
Key Responsibilities:
- Integration Leadership: Learn and master the architecture and functionality of direct (client integrates with our API) and reverse (we integrate with client APIs) integrations.
- Serve as the go-to expert for all integration-related queries.
- Process Improvement Identify, document, and implement enhancements to integration APIs based on client and internal feedback.
- Apply Enterprise Integration patterns to optimize scalability and interoperability.
- Team Development Lead the onboarding process for new integration developers.
- Provide mentorship and training to the integration team, fostering a culture of technical excellence.
- Collaboration and Communication: Work closely with product managers, architects, and client teams to align integration workflows with business objectives. Act as a liaison between technical and non-technical stakeholders to resolve challenges efficiently.
- Technical Execution Design, develop, and maintain robust integration services using Java and the Spring Boot framework.
- Ensure high-quality code by writing comprehensive unit and integration tests.
- Utilize containerization technologies (Docker, Kubernetes) and message streaming tools (Kafka).
Qualifications & Skills:
- Bachelor’s degree in Computer Science, Engineering, or a related field.
- 5+ years of backend development experience using Java and Spring Boot.
- Strong understanding of RESTful APIs, messaging systems, and integration frameworks.
- Hands-on experience with relational databases (e.g., MySQL, PostgreSQL).
- Proficiency in using containerization technologies (Docker and Kubernetes).
- Excellent problem-solving skills and attention to detail.
Nice to Have:
- Familiarity with system integrations and Enterprise Integration patterns.
- Experience in leading technical teams or mentoring developers.
- Understanding of microservices architecture.
- Knowledge of CI/CD pipelines and tools.
- Locations
- Birkirkara
- Remote status
- Hybrid Remote
Birkirkara
·
Hybrid Remote
Integrations Tech Lead
Loading application form
Already working at Eeze?
Let’s recruit together and find your next colleague.